How to get a FastLane Account

The National Science Foundation requires that all proposals and project reports be submitted electronically via FastLane. If you are not already a FastLane user you will need a password. Only staff in Research and Sponsored Programs can assign passwords.

To request a password, call or e-mail to Lori Messer, or Stephen Williams, in Research and Sponsored Programs. You will need to provide the following information:

NSF ID (if applicable or known)
First Name
Middle Initial
Last Name
Suffix (Jr, Sr, etc.)
E-mail address
Campus phone number
Campus fax number
Department
Degree type (e.g. Ph.D.)
Degree year

Research and Sponsored Programs will assign a temporary password. When you log into FastLane you will be asked to select a permanent password. Passwords must be 6-20 characters in length and include at least one alphabetic and one numeric character. Additionally, passwords are not case sensitive.

Research and Sponsored Programs can provide assistance in the use of FastLane. Additional assistance can be found in the following document: https://www.fastlane.nsf.gov/a1/newstan.htm
